    I’m seeing log messages like this after updating to WordPress 5.4.1:

    PHP Deprecated: edit_category_form is deprecated since version 3.0.0! Use {$taxonomy}_add_form instead. in /opt/bitnami/apps/wordpress/htdocs/wp-includes/functions.php on line 5088.

    A search of my codebase shows that this plugin is using edit_category_form. Deactivating this plugin, but the messages doesn’t stop and my website redirected to mysite/install.php.

    Any suggestions would be greatly appreciated.
